Wilkesboro North Carolina BEACHES & WATERFRONT ESCAPES


Listed below are the best beaches and waterfront escapes near Wilkesboro, North Carolina.



1. W. Kerr Scott Reservoir

Lakefront Recreation Gem. Surrounded by rolling forested hills, W. Kerr Scott Reservoir boasts three public swim beaches perfect for swimming, sunbathing, and paddling. Miles of lakeside trails, scenic picnic spots, and ample wildlife-watching make it a prime spot for outdoor fun.

2. Berry Mountain Park

Family Beach Retreat. This seasonal park features a sandy swim beach, playground, and shaded picnic areas overlooking the lake. Visitors enjoy water access, basketball, and tranquil mountain views just minutes from town.

3. Fort Hamby Park

Lakeside Beach Oasis. Fort Hamby Park offers a designated beach area for swimming, lakeside picnicking, and family-friendly relaxation. A blend of hiking trails, boat access, and campground amenities makes it a local favorite for a full day by the water.

4. Fish Dam Creek Park

Scenic Lakefront Park. Located near the dam, Fish Dam Creek Park features a swim area, picnic shelters, and sweeping views of W. Kerr Scott Lake. Visitors enjoy easy access to hiking and biking trails as well as spacious fields for recreation.

5. Dark Mountain Park

Active Beach Adventure. Dark Mountain Park offers lakeshore recreation with a swim beach, picnic shelters, and trailheads for hiking and mountain biking. The park's open fields and scenic water views create an energetic, nature-rich atmosphere.

6. Dam Site Park

Central Waterfront Hub. Dam Site Park sits by the reservoir's visitor center and features a swim area, picnic shelter, and education center. It's a favorite for family gatherings, wildlife observation, and lakefront leisure.

7. Stone Mountain State Park

Mountain Stream Beach. Stone Mountain State Park provides riverbank beaches along clear mountain streams, ideal for wading, sunbathing, and picnicking after a hike. Natural pools and dramatic granite scenery make for a memorable day outdoors.

8. Lake Norman State Park

Largest Lake Beach. Lake Norman State Park's large swim beach offers sandy shores, calm swimming waters, and plenty of space for lakeside games and sunbathing. Visitors also enjoy boat rentals, fishing, and shaded picnic sites along North Carolina's largest man-made lake.

9. Hanging Rock State Park

Mountain Lake Beach. Hanging Rock State Park features a scenic lake with a designated sandy beach for swimming, sunbathing, and picnics. The park's mountain backdrop, hiking trails, and lush setting offer a refreshing retreat.

10. Lake James State Park

Blue Ridge Beachfront. Lake James State Park welcomes visitors to a wide beach with clear mountain water, perfect for swimming and paddling. The park's expansive shoreline invites hiking, wildlife spotting, and relaxing lake days with mountain views.
